Gisela Bartling & Liz Echelmeyer 
Problemanalyse im psychotherapeutischen Prozess 
Leitfaden für die Praxis

支持
The new edition of this standard work on problem analysis and treatment planning provides an updated guide for the conception of cases in clinical and psychotherapeutic training and practice. The book provides guidance through the entire process of psychotherapy: selecting problems and establishing a diagnosis, analysing problems and behaviour at various levels, setting goals, creating motivation to achieve change, and selecting and evaluating therapeutic interventions within a framework of comprehensive treatment planning. This guide thus represents an outstanding aid for the orientation and structuring of an expert assessment report in the context of submitting applications for therapy. Selected working materials included in the book are available to readers for downloading.

关于作者

Dr. Gisela Bartling is Principal of the IPP in Münster.
Dipl.-Psych. Margarita Engberding is a lecturer and supervisor at the IPP in Münster.
Dipl.-Psych. Liz Echelmeyer is a clinical psychologist, psychotherapist and lecturer/supervisor in private practice.
